Thanks for the compliments!

The softkey buttons are controlled by several variables including .png images as well as registry values for sizes and margins (typically found in whatever theme you have sleected (HTC Black.tsk). If you want to delve into what it looks like go into H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Today and go through the different sub-menu's.

I just checked the Music tab and the volume control bar comes up fine for me on the left side when changing the volume up/down. (I am using the 5/8 release)
